Download file

Size: 104.4×178.8 mm (4.11×7.04 “), Stitches: 15952
Size: 127.4×218.2 mm (5.02×8.59 “), Stitches: 21913
Size: 139.1×238.1 mm (5.48×9.37 “), Stitches: 25379
Size: 158.0×270.4 mm (6.22×10.65 “), Stitches: 31446

Formats: .dst, .jef, .pec, .vip, .hus, .pes, .exp, .sew, .dat, .vp3, xxx
